MediaAlpha Momentum Analysis

Momentum indicators are widely used technical indicators which help to measure the pace at which the price of specific equity, such as MediaAlpha, fluctuates. Many momentum indicators also complement each other and can be helpful when the market is rising or falling as compared to MediaAlphaMediaAlpha's Momentum analyses are specifically helpful, as they help investors time the market using mark points where the market can reverse. The reversal spots are usually identified through divergence between price movement and momentum.

The market value of MediaAlpha is measured differently than its book value, which is the value of MediaAlpha that is recorded on the company's balance sheet. Investors also form their own opinion of MediaAlpha's value that differs from its market value or its book value, called intrinsic value, which is MediaAlpha's true underlying value. Investors use various methods to calculate intrinsic value and buy a stock when its market value falls below its intrinsic value. Because MediaAlpha's market value can be influenced by many factors that don't directly affect MediaAlpha's underlying business (such as a pandemic or basic market pessimism), market value can vary widely from intrinsic value.
Understanding that MediaAlpha's value differs from its trading price is crucial, as each reflects different aspects of the company. MediaAlpha technical stock analysis exercises models and trading practices based on price and volume transformations, such as the moving averages, relative strength index, regressions, price and return correlations, business cycles, stock market cycles, or different charting patterns.
A focus of MediaAlpha technical analysis is to determine if market prices reflect all relevant information impacting that market. A technical analyst looks at the history of MediaAlpha trading pattern rather than external drivers such as economic, fundamental, or social events. It is believed that price action tends to repeat itself due to investors' collective, patterned behavior. Hence technical analysis focuses on identifiable price trends and conditions. More Info...
